One thing that is annoying about the Mastodon web interface is that you can't keep it running for any extended period of time - it will start lagging like hell to the point where the tab becomes defunct.

you mean like tumblr, twitter, tweetdeck?nothing under the sun. Product people love endless scrolling, frontends devs are lazy.Hence we get an everloading DOM without any consideration for long-term use, and a shit UX (Ever tried to reload the page? Go back in history?) :((the worst thing in all this is that a proper endless scroll, with anchors for navigation & DOM preserving is not that hard to do..)

@void I never had that issue with Tweetdeck. Can keep it running for 12h+ and the tab still is as fast as before. Likely because Tweetdeck actually unloads older posts (they will be loaded again if you scroll down).
